On Fri, Sep 14, 2012 at 02:58:04AM -0600, Liu Bo wrote:
In some workloads we have nested joining transaction operations,
eg.
run_delalloc_nocow
btrfs_join_transaction
cow_file_range
btrfs_join_transaction
it can be a serious bug since each trans handler has only two
block_rsv, orig_rsv and block_rsv, which means we may lose our
first block_rsv after two joining transaction operations:
1) btrfs_start_transaction
trans->block_rsv = A
2) btrfs_join_transaction
trans->orig_rsv = trans->block_rsv; ---> orig_rsv is now A
trans->block_rsv = B
3) btrfs_join_transaction
trans->orig_rsv = trans->block_rsv; ---> orig_rsv is now B
trans->block_rsv = C
...I'd like to see the actual stack trace where this happens, because I don't think it can happen. And if it is we need to look at that specific case and adjust it as necessary and not add a bunch of kmallocs just to track the block_rsv, because frankly it's not that big of a deal, it was just put into place in case somebody wasn't expecting a call they made to start another transaction and reset the block_rsv, which I don't actually think happens anywhere. So NAK on this patch, give me more information so I can figure out the right way to deal with this. Thanks, Josef
